Enforce the Traffic Regulation Order at Long Lane – Install Safety Cameras Now

We’re calling on East Riding Council and the Police and Crime Commissioner to take action now.

Residents across Beverley have had enough of the dangerous and illegal driving at the Woodmansey Mile / Long Lane junction. Despite the new Traffic Regulation Order (TRO) being in place, drivers are continuing to make illegal turns, ignoring signage and putting pedestrians — especially schoolchildren, cyclists, and families — at serious risk.

Long Lane is supposed to be a designated quiet lane. But with cars using it as a cut-through, speeding, and overtaking dangerously, it's anything but quiet — it's become a hazard.

We’re asking East Riding of Yorkshire Council and the Police and Crime Commissioner to:

  1. Install enforcement cameras at the junction to uphold the TRO
  2. Fine or prosecute those who break the law
  3. Introduce traffic calming measures along Long Lane and Woodmansey Mile
  4. Build a safe footpath on Long Lane to protect pedestrians

Why this matters:

This is about safety, not inconvenience. We should not have to wait for a serious accident to happen before proper enforcement is put in place. Cameras will save lives, reduce congestion, and restore peace of mind to our community.
